Understanding Hydroxyethyl Cellulose
Before diving into where to buy HEC, it’s essential to understand what it is and why it’s beneficial. Hydroxyethyl cellulose is derived from natural cellulose, making it biodegradable and environmentally friendly. It serves as a thickening agent, which means it can increase the viscosity of a liquid without significantly changing its properties. This makes it an ideal component in lotions, shampoos, and other personal care products.
Moreover, HEC is non-ionic and has excellent film-forming capabilities. This makes it valuable in various applications, from stabilizing emulsions in cosmetic formulations to providing controlled release in drug delivery systems.
Where to Buy Hydroxyethyl Cellulose
1. Online Retailers
One of the most convenient ways to purchase HEC is through online retailers. Websites like Amazon, eBay, and specialty chemical suppliers provide a range of options for both small and bulk purchases. Make sure to check the product specifications and the sellers' ratings and reviews to ensure you are buying high-quality HEC.
2. Specialty Chemical Suppliers
For those seeking specific grades of hydroxyethyl cellulose, contacting specialty chemical suppliers is an excellent idea. Companies such as Sigma-Aldrich, Thermo Fisher, and Ashland are known for providing high-quality industrial-grade HEC. They also often offer technical support and documentation, which might be necessary for commercial applications.
3. Cosmetic Ingredient Suppliers
If you’re formulating cosmetic products, consider reaching out to suppliers that specialize in cosmetic ingredients. Suppliers like DFR Celestial, MakingCosmetics, and Lotioncrafter offer a variety of HEC products tailored for personal care formulations. These vendors not only provide HEC but also additional resources on how to incorporate it into your formulations effectively.
4. Pharmaceutical Suppliers
For pharmaceutical applications, it is crucial to purchase HEC from reputable pharmaceutical suppliers. Companies such as BASF and Croda produce HEC that meets the stringent quality standards required for drug manufacturing. These suppliers often provide extensive technical data sheets that explain the product’s suitability for various applications.
5. Local Suppliers and Distributors
If you prefer to buy locally, consider searching for chemical distributors or suppliers in your area. Websites like ThomasNet can help you find local suppliers who may stock hydroxyethyl cellulose. Purchasing locally can sometimes save on shipping costs and allows you to receive your product more quickly.
6. Bulk Purchasing for Businesses
For businesses requiring large quantities of HEC, reaching out to manufacturers directly could be the most cost-effective approach. Many manufacturers are willing to negotiate prices for bulk orders, which can significantly reduce your overall costs. Establishing a direct relationship with a manufacturer can also ensure a consistent supply for your business needs.
Things to Consider When Buying HEC
- Purity and Quality Always check the purity level of the HEC you are buying, especially for pharmaceutical and cosmetic uses. Look for certificates of analysis (COA) to verify product quality. - Application Be clear about your intended use. Different grades of HEC may be suited to specific applications, so ensure you buy the right type.
- Regulatory Compliance If your product is meant for human use, confirm that the HEC complies with relevant regulations, such as those set by the FDA or the European Commission.
- Customer Support Choose suppliers that offer strong customer support and resources to assist you in using HEC effectively in your formulations.
